Powwow
Every summer in the area that I live, there is a powwow
which is a weekend where aboriginal people come from different towns and cities
to meet up and have a gathering. During this gathering people put up food
stands and little shops so you could buy things. The main reason to go to a
powwow is to dance. There are drummers in the centre of the circle and they
sing and people dress up in their cultural costumes and they dance around the
drummers to show their respect to all the aboriginals and everything we have
gotten and are thankful for.
